Home Tags Crickets

Tag: Crickets

Word of the Day – Sept. 15 – Stridulate

Verb: Stridulate (STRIJ-uh-layt) Definition: To make a shrill creaking noise by rubbing together special bodily structures -- used especially of male insects (as...